air bubbles in fuel line
 
I just got a used Tmaxx and just got it running, my problem is that the engine keeps stalling sometimes when at full throttle and sometimes when just turning at iddle. I did notice constant little bubbles in the fuel line leading to the carb, they get bigger as the throttle returns to iddle. The fuel line is brand new and the tank cap seems to be sealing fine, could it be the tank? How can I check? What else could it be?

Being a used car most likely there are a few air leaks around the engine.Air bubbles in the fuel line are usually an indication of an air leak.
